  • I am trying to download firefox to my android and get this meesage" there are no android phones associated with this account " what am I doing wrong?

    I would like to sync my laptop and android but get the above message

    To install Firefox from the Android Market web site, you must be logged in to the web site and your phone using the same Google account. If that doesn't work, you can follow the instructions here for other ways to install Firefox for Android: https://wiki.mozilla.org/Mobile/Platforms/Android

  • Let there be sound! (HP dv3500/dv3510nr)

    I was having trouble getting sound to work on my laptop (an HP dv3510nr), but adding the "model" information for ALSA got it functioning correctly.
    options snd_hda_intel model=hp-m4
    Add the line above to /etc/modprobe.d/sound and sound should now work!
